Skip to content

1. Prefácio

O PDF do documento está disponível |AQUI|.

Os exemplos no documento estão disponíveis |AQUI|.

Este documento fornece uma lista de scripts Python em vários campos:

  • os fundamentos da linguagem,
  • gestão de bases de dados MySQL,
  • programação de redes TCP/IP,
  • programação web,
  • arquiteturas de três camadas e programação baseada em interfaces.

Este não é um curso de Python, mas sim uma coleção de exemplos destinada a programadores que já tenham utilizado uma linguagem de script como Perl, PHP ou VBScript, ou a programadores habituados a linguagens tipadas como Java ou C# que estejam interessados em descobrir uma linguagem de script orientada para objetos. Este documento não é adequado para leitores com pouca ou nenhuma experiência em programação.

Este documento também não é uma coleção de «melhores práticas». Desenvolvedores experientes podem achar que parte do código poderia ser escrito de forma mais elegante. O único objetivo deste documento é fornecer exemplos para quem deseja começar rapidamente a utilizar a linguagem Python. Posteriormente, podem aprofundar a sua aprendizagem com outros recursos.

Quem achar este documento «demasiado acelerado» ou não suficientemente explícito poderá preferir o tutorial aprofundado de Gérard Swinnen [http://python.developpez.com/cours/TutoSwinnen/] ou, de forma mais geral, os tutoriais de Python em developpez.com [http://python.developpez.com/cours]. A informação definitiva pode ser encontrada no URL [http://docs.python.org/].

Os scripts estão comentados e a sua saída na consola é reproduzida. Por vezes, são fornecidas explicações adicionais. Este documento requer uma leitura ativa: para compreender um script, deve ler o seu código, os comentários e a saída na consola.

Os exemplos deste documento estão disponíveis |AQUI|. São fornecidos como uma solução do Visual Studio 2010, mas os scripts podem ser utilizados fora deste ambiente.

 

Para mais informações: